If you need any advice on them then I can help as I designed the one that HRP manufactures. Crazy Quiff's are just a rip off of my design.

My design is a development of the Autocavan pedal box originally designed in the 1980's. Historic Racecar Preperations are effectivly the same company that produced them then for Autocavan. I worked there when they still made them for Autocavan and then redesigned them when JTM Racing became HRP..

As for people having problems fitting them, its always come down to them not being fitted correctly or expecting too much from 30 year old bodyshells :) At my last count I've fitted 16 myself and never had a problem. :)

I have fitten an Autocavan one and it fitted perfectly.  I obviously had to take my steering column from my old set up but it fitted into the Autocavan one as if it was factory.  I have the twin bias pedal box and hydraulic clutch.  It was all very simple and I had it done literally in 2 hours.
